Komodo, brought to you by the owner of infamous nightclub LIV, David Grutman, is an Asian restaurant that echoes his South Beach party spot. It's stylish, swanky, and muli-leveled, with an animal-printed dining room. The upper floor is home to a series of wood enclaves where diners can enjoy a view of the scene below and enjoy the black cod skewers and namesake Grutman pastrami eggroll with pickled cabbage and Chinese mustard.

The Brickell bird’s nest that is Komodo’s signature sight is an ideal place from which to enjoy a Cosmo. But this pan-Asian hotspot best known for its Peking duck is more than just a collection of artfully-crafted sticks. Its upstairs lounge is as scene-y as anywhere in South Beach, and the promoter dinner mecca on the restaurant’s main floor is full of people as beautiful as the décor.
